What is Market Segmentation?
The first step toward running a more efficient, more targeted marketing campaign is to engage in customer segmentation. Segmentation involves dividing the individuals, households or companies/organizations in your target market into distinct categories based upon relevant distinguishing factors. Leveraging the results of this type of segmentation work, the marketer can target some segments while skipping over others completely. The marketer can also choose to adjust the message and marketing channel based upon the segment they are targeting.

The Pitfalls of Traditional Segmentation
Companies that implement customer segmentation strategies are already ahead of the game versus those companies that do not. They will almost certainly achieve a higher return on their marketing dollar investment since they are increasing the response rate of their customers.
However, most companies who engage in segmentation still face two common pitfalls of traditional segmentation:
1. They base their segmentation methodology on guesses rather than upon hard data.
2. They conduct segmentation based upon simple demographic dimensions of their customers – such as age, income, and marital status – rather than electing to gain a more complete, subtle and potentially powerful set of insights into their customers.

Best Customer Profiling
MindEcology’s best customer profiling process transcends traditional customer segmentation by building a more robust, accurate and sophisticated profile – or model – of your customers. We leverage your existing. historical customer data and order history data to divide your customers into segments.
For our clients who sell directly to households and individuals (B2C companies), we create segments based upon the following types of factors:
- Demographic
- Psychographic
- Population density/urbanicity
- Geographic
- Buying behavioral
- Attitudes and opinions
- Purchasing history vis-à-vis your company or organization
For our clients who sell directly to other companies (B2B companies), we create segments based upon factors such as:
- Company size, by revenue or employee count
- Concentration of competitors in the area
- Population density/urbanicity (in some cases)
- Proximity to other types of companies
- Industry (SIC or NAICS code)
- Purchasing history vis-à-vis your company or organization
Once we have divided your customers into segments, we then assign each segment an index score that expresses the value of each segment to your company or organization. We rank the segments and isolate the top 10-15% of segments, calling them your “top segmentation clusters.”
Your top segmentation clusters are the tell-tale markers identifying those prospects who are not only more likely to buy from you (i.e., who have high propensity to buy) but also are likely to spend more money with you when they do (i.e., who have high buying power). These companies represent a customer DNA profile that is unique to your company.
Individuals, households, or companies that match your best customer profile are 3-5 or more times likely to respond to your marketing and sales outreach efforts.
